You do not file Form 1099 for payments of personal expenses. They are only to be filed for payments in conjunction with your trade or business. So unless your handyman or landscapers were working on something related to your business, you do not send them a 1099. If you keep a personal landscaper or handyman on your household staff, you may need to send them a W-2.
